Job Description

We are now looking for a Full-stack Developer to join our team! As such, you will be responsible for the design and development of our core product, from the web portal to backend systems. You will also help evolve the overall architecture of the application and continuously work to ensure maximum performance, usability and stability.

YOUR RESPONSIBILTIES:

  • Implementation of a robust set of services and APIs to power the web application.
  • Implementation of new features including backend, frontend and API components.
  • Building reusable code and libraries for future use.
  • Stay abreast of developments in web applications and programming languages
  • Optimization of the application for maximum speed and scalability.
  • Interact with the rest of the team and foster our culture of review and code quality.
  • Design and implement software components to facilitate integration with front end applications, Translation engines and Content Management systems.
  • Help to evolve the e-commerce platform by promoting engineering best practices. • Write understandable, testable code with an eye towards maintainability, scalability and internationalization.
  • Monitor and maintain the applications deployed in production
  • Collaborate with other developers by taking part in pair programming and contributing in white boarding solutions, team discussions, and task breakdown.

YOUR SKILLS

  • Understanding of fundamental design principles behind a scalable, reliable and alwayson applications.
  • Proficient in the back-end technologies such as .NET, PHP & Python
  • .Design and development of web applications with brilliant UX and design in JavaScript, Angular.
  • Monitor and maintain the applications deployed in production
  • Design and development of server-side technologies to scale and deploy custom reports.
  • Occasional design and development of server-side technologies to scale and deploy into new use-cases.
  • Understanding of DBMS, MSSQL, MYSQL, how to use them and how to interface to them
  • Proficient in Web Development Technologies such as Angular, Node.Js, Projectoriented work experience, solution architecture.
  • Proficient understanding of git.
  • Interest in and understanding of design principles that enable automated testing/unit test.
  • Similarity with our technical stacks Python, Rails and good understanding of agile, lean, and DevOps principles.
Job Overview
Job Posted:
1 week ago
Job Expire In:
2w 1d
Job Type
Full Time
Job Role
Executive
Education
Bachelor Degree
Experience
3+ Years